Photographs of '48 for the Red Book will be taken in Memorial Hall at registration for the winter term, it was announced yesterday by the newly-appointed Red Book Committee. Freshmen who enter next term will be photographed when they take their step test.
Newly elected to the Red Book staff, which will work under the guidance of Frederick P. Murphy '47, are Arthur C. McGill as business manager, Warwick Potter, Jr., as advertising manager, William C. Garcelon as circulation manager, and Jerome Dickinson as publicity manager.
